Synthflow

Voice AI

Enterprise voice AI platform that automates phone calls using AI voice agents for both inbound and outbound communications. Handles call routing, appointment booking, voicemail detection, and SMS follow-ups with CRM integrations.

Ultravox (formerly Fixie.ai)

🟡Low Code

Voice AI

Real-time, speech-native voice AI platform that processes audio directly without text conversion, enabling fast, natural voice conversations for AI agents with sub-second latency and preservation of paralinguistic signals.

    Synthflow - Pros & Cons

    Pros

    • ✓In-house telephony stack delivers <100ms latency, noticeably faster than platforms relying on third-party carriers
    • ✓Enterprise-grade compliance triple stack (HIPAA, SOC 2, PCI DSS) supports healthcare, finance, and PCI-regulated workloads
    • ✓Pay-As-You-Go pricing means you only pay for actual calls and chats — no upfront cost to build and test agents
    • ✓Native CRM integrations with GoHighLevel, HubSpot, and Salesforce eliminate custom integration work
    • ✓50+ language and regional accent support enables global deployment from a single platform
    • ✓BELL deployment framework provides structured implementation methodology rather than just raw tooling

    Cons

    • ✗Pay-As-You-Go pricing can become unpredictable at high call volumes compared to flat-rate competitors
    • ✗Public pricing tiers are not transparently published, requiring sales contact for enterprise quotes
    • ✗Steeper learning curve for the modular voice flow designer compared to template-only no-code voice tools
    • ✗Heavy enterprise positioning may be overkill for solo founders or very small businesses
    • ✗Advanced customization (custom escalation rules, fallback responses) requires meaningful upfront design work

    Ultravox (formerly Fixie.ai) - Pros & Cons

    Pros

    • ✓Industry-leading speech processing with 97% accuracy on Big Bench Audio benchmarks
    • ✓Sub-second response times enable natural, real-time voice conversations
    • ✓Speech-native architecture preserves tone and emotional context lost in text conversion
    • ✓Developer-friendly APIs and SDKs for rapid voice agent deployment
    • ✓Built-in telephony integrations eliminate complex third-party setup requirements

    Cons

    • ✗Newer platform with smaller community compared to established voice AI solutions
    • ✗Speech-native approach requires consistent audio quality for optimal performance
    • ✗JavaScript/TypeScript focus may not align with Python-heavy ML teams
    • ✗Limited offline processing capabilities due to cloud-based speech models
